Checklist: Evaluating Teacher Qualifications

Academic Degrees

First and foremost, look for a bachelor's or master's degree in mathematics, mathematics education, or a closely related field. A strong academic foundation in mathematics is crucial for any teacher, especially when tackling the challenging Singapore MOE syllabus, be it for PSLE math tuition or JC H2 math. Degrees from reputable universities, both local (like NUS, NTU, SMU) and overseas, signal a certain level of mathematical rigor and problem-solving skills. After all, you want someone who truly understands the underlying concepts, not just someone who can memorise formulas, right?

MOE Registration

In Singapore, while not mandatory for all private tutors, registration with the Ministry of Education (MOE) is a strong indicator of a tutor's commitment and adherence to certain standards. MOE-registered teachers typically have experience teaching in local schools and are familiar with the Singaporean education system and its nuances. This is especially valuable for online math tuition, where understanding the specific demands of the PSLE, O-Levels, or A-Levels is paramount. Plus, it gives you that extra peace of mind, knowing they're not just anyhowly teaching your kid.

Teaching Experience

Experience matters, especially when it comes to teaching mathematics. Look for tutors or instructors with a proven track record of at least a few years, ideally with experience teaching the specific level your child is at (primary, secondary, or JC). Experienced teachers have likely encountered a wide range of student learning styles and challenges, and have developed effective strategies for explaining complex concepts. They've also seen the trends in exam questions, so they can better prepare your child for what's coming. Don't play play!

Addressing Parental Concerns About Pre-Recorded Tuition

Many Singaporean parents, understandably, have concerns about the effectiveness of pre-recorded online math tuition. Will their child stay engaged? Will the learning be personalized enough? Here's how to address those worries:

1. Engagement is Key:

  • Interactive Elements: Look for courses that incorporate interactive elements like quizzes, polls, and drag-and-drop activities to keep students actively involved.
  • Gamification: Some courses use gamification techniques, such as points, badges, and leaderboards, to motivate students and make learning more fun.
  • Bite-Sized Lessons: Shorter, focused lessons can be more engaging than long, drawn-out lectures.
  • Visual Appeal: Well-designed courses with clear visuals and animations can help to capture and maintain students' attention.

2. Personalization is Possible:

  • Adaptive Learning: Some advanced platforms use adaptive learning technology to personalize the learning experience based on each student's individual needs and progress.
  • Supplementary Q&A: Choose courses that offer supplementary Q&A sessions with the teacher, either live or via email, to address individual questions and provide personalized guidance.
  • Progress Tracking: Regular progress reports can help parents and students identify areas where they need to focus their efforts.
  • Self-Paced Learning: The ability to learn at their own pace allows students to spend more time on challenging topics and move quickly through areas they already understand.

3. Overcoming the Lack of Face-to-Face Interaction:

  • Virtual Study Groups: Encourage your child to join virtual study groups with other students taking the same course. This can provide a sense of community and allow them to collaborate and learn from each other.
  • Regular Check-Ins: Schedule regular check-ins with your child to discuss their progress and address any concerns they may have.
  • Parental Involvement: Be actively involved in your child's learning by reviewing their work, asking them questions, and providing encouragement.

First things first, check the tutor's qualifications. Does the person have a degree in mathematics, education, or a related field? A piece of paper doesn't guarantee brilliance, but it shows they've put in the effort to understand the subject deeply. Look for qualifications from reputable universities, lah. Even better if they have a Postgraduate Diploma in Education (PGDE) from NIE (National Institute of Education)—that means they're trained to teach according to the Singapore MOE syllabus.

Next, experience is key. How long has the tutor been teaching math, especially at the level your child is at (Primary, Secondary, or JC)? Someone with years of experience understands the common pitfalls students face and knows how to explain concepts in a way that actually clicks. Look for tutors who have a proven track record of helping students improve their grades in PSLE math tuition, O-Level math help, or even JC H2 math tuition.

Don't be shy to ask for testimonials or reviews. What do other parents and students say about the tutor's teaching style and effectiveness? Have they helped students jump from a C to an A? Did they make math less scary and more sedap? Real feedback is gold.

Also, see if the tutor has experience with the Singapore MOE syllabus. Our syllabus is own kind, you know? It’s not enough to just know math; the tutor needs to understand how it's taught in Singapore schools. They should be familiar with the specific topics covered at each level and the types of questions that are commonly asked in exams. This is especially crucial for nailing those tricky math problem-solving skills.
